Turn-A Gundam getting a US DVD release!

I just pre-ordered my copy over at Rightstuf and boy am I excited. Now is our chance as fans to support this franchise and hopefully with enough sales we might get some other Gundam series stateside.

So lets do our part and wish for the best!

Some info...

• Media - DVD
• Format - Japanese Audio with English Subtitles
• 625 Minutes (Episodes 1-25)
• Date Available - Jun 30 2015
